Alvin J. Tait
Alvin J. Tait, 83, of East Metzger Avenue died at 2:26 a.m. Tuesday at Butler Memorial Hospital surrounded by his family.
Born July 2, 1924, in Louisville, Ohio, he was the son of Ralph "RB" and Edna M. O'Donnell Tait.
He was a retired electronics technician superintendent at the T.W. Phillips Oil and Gas Co. for 42 years. He was a graduate of Coyne Electrical School in Chicago.
He attended the First United Methodist Church.
He served in the Coast Guard during World War II in Europe and Japan. He was a member of the Butler Lodge 272 F&AM, the Ancient and Accepted Scottish Rite Valley of New Castle, and a former elder and deacon at St. Paul United Church of Christ.
He was an avid outdoorsman, gardener, traveler and storyteller.
He is survived by his loving wife, Beryl Christie Tait, whom he married March 28, 1993; three daughters, Pamela L. Tait of Butler, Sue Lancaster and her husband, Hayden, of Vienna, W.Va., and Sallie Benjamin and her husband, Tom, of Butler; four grandchildren, David, Elise, Adam and Ashley Gale; a great-grandson, Ian; and a number of nieces, nephews and cousins.He was preceded in death by his wife, Beatrice A. Sweeney Tait, who died Aug. 22, 1991; and a brother, Robert Tait.
